This patch series, based on v3.12-rc7, prepares various Renesas drivers
for migration to multiplatform kernels by enabling their compilation or
otherwise fixing them on all ARM platforms. The patches are pretty
straightforward and are described in their commit message.

I'd like to get all these patches merged in v3.14. As they will need to go
through their respective subsystems' trees, I would appreciate if all
maintainers involved could notify me when they merge patches from this
series in their tree to help me tracking the merge status. I don't plan
to send pull requests individually for these patches, and I will repost
patches individually if changes are requested during review.

If you believe the issue should be solved in a different way (for instance
by removing the architecture dependency completely) please reply to the
cover letter to let other maintainers chime in.
Exactly this was my doubt. If we let these drivers build on all ARM
platforms... Maybe we should just let them build everywhere? Unless there
are real ARM dependencies. Maybe you could try to remove the restriction
and try to build them all on x86?
My concern is that they might not build on some architectures for which I 
don't have a cross-compiler. For instance not all architecture define ioread32 
and iowrite32, which some drivers might rely on. What about depending on 
SUPERH || ARM || COMPILE_TEST to start with, in order not to push compilation 
breakages to mainline ?
